Who Owns Camping World?

Camping World is a publicly traded company on the stock market. This means that if you’d like to be a partial owner of the company, all you have to do is buy a few stocks in the company and you can consider yourself a shareholder.

However, you better have pretty deep pockets if you want to own a large percentage of the business. At last count, the largest shareholder owns just over 600,000 shares of the company’s stock, which is worth an estimated $16.5 million.

Who Owns the Most Stock in Camping World?

The largest stock owner in the company is the company’s CEO, Marcus Lemonis. At the start of November 2022, Marcus Lemonis owned approximately 872,000 shares of stock.

However, on November 22, 2022, Lemonis sold 272,097 of his shares to leave him with 600,171 total shares worth approximately $16.5 million.

What Is Camping World Net Worth?

According to Stock Analysis, Camping World Holdings (CWH) has a net worth of $2.33 billion as of November 2022.

With so many RVs sold since 2019, they’ve done well financially and continue to do well through servicing RVs, selling accessories, and selling RVs.

What Is the History of Camping World?

David Garvin was 23 years old when he founded the first Camping World in 1966. Garvin saw the potential in creating a business for RV accessories, and it quickly grew into a massive empire. Garvin served as the owner until Good Sam Enterprises purchased the company from him in 1997. Unfortunately, Mr. Garvin passed away in August 2014.

After Garvin sold the company in 1997, it experienced tremendous growth. Between 2000 and 2009, the chain opened an additional 58 stores in 32 states. They expanded to sell both new and used RVs at some of their locations and in 2003. However, one of their biggest milestones was opening their 100th store in 2013.

The company became a publicly traded company in 2016 and raised $251 million. The company acquired Gander Mountain and Overton’s Gander Mountain in 2017. The company continues to progress and grow its position in the RV market.

Who Is Camping World’s Biggest Competitor?

Camping World’s biggest competitors are dealerships like Lazy Days and General RV. These are massive dealerships with hundreds of RVs at each location. They all sell a lot of RVs and claim to have the largest dealerships in the nation.
